An improved and simplified approach for the design of nearly perfect reconstructed pseudo-transmultiplexer is proposed. Blackman window and its variants are used to design the prototype filter. The most important problem in the design of transmultiplexer is the existence of interference parameters like inter-channel interference (ICI) and inter-symbol interference (ISI). A generalized linear optimization technique is proposed to minimize these undesired interference parameters. The cutoff frequency of the prototype filter is selected as a variable parameter. The main feature of the proposed design scheme is that it significantly reduces the interference parameters of the transmultiplexer.
